Dining Services is both an administrative department of the college and a branch of Sodexho Campus Services. It operates the both of the dining halls and the Snack Bar, essentially giving it a monopoly over dining at Carleton College.
History
The Carleton Food Service operated college dining halls until 1970, when the college contracted with Saga Education Food Services.
SAGA, as it was known on campus, was purchased by Host Marriott in 1986. Three years later, SAGA was purchased by Sodexho Alliance, a French multi-national.
